After two weeks of competitive rest, Carlos Alcaraz returns to the ring and does so focused on keeping the number 1 ahead of the last Grand Slam of the season: the US Open.

The first obstacle on that path for the young Spanish tennis player will be Ben Shelton. The North American is a tough nut to crack on fast tracks and is a good touchstone in the debut of the Murcian at the Masters 1,000 in Toronto (Canada).

Alcaraz has a lot to face to be able to keep the number 1 since he defends very few points in this American tour prior to the US Open. Without going any further, last year he lost in Toronto in the first round against Tommy Paul (7-6, 6-7 and 3-6) and therefore does not defend points.

After an exceptional grass tour, with victories at Queen's and Wimbledon, Alcaraz has 14 consecutive victories and only Djokovic has managed to defeat him in his last 20 matches, and it was because the Spanish tennis player ended up injured.

Alcaraz and Shelton have not faced each other in an official match since both are very young, born in 2003 and 2002 respectively, and therefore today's duel will tip the balance in favor of one or the other.

The meeting between Alcaraz and Shelton will take place on center court no earlier than 01:00 am from Wednesday to Thursday. Viewers in Spain can tune in to Movistar Deportes to watch the game live.
